**First-day checklist — Archive Room (Basement Level 1)**

Before your orientation tour ends, visit the archive room beneath the Hollis Wing at Draycott Mews. Take the service stairs, not the goods lift, as the lift requires a separate fob. The room holds original project files for the Meridian programme; nothing leaves without a sign-out slip from the archivist, Tomas Eilert. Lights are on a ten-minute timer, so note the switch by the door. To enter, key in the code below.

door code, yagap-bahof: bdg-O-05

14:22 — Quenby deployed the revamped reset flow for Lanternly Accounts to the canary pool. Token expiry was mistakenly set to 90 seconds instead of 15 minutes, causing a spike in failed resets within eight minutes. Rollback initiated at 14:31; canary restored by 14:36. For orientation purposes, the offending artifact is recorded directly below.

session token of hawif-bajog = htk6_9ab8da

## Who to ping about GiftNote

Welcome aboard! GiftNote is our donation-receipt mailer for the Larchfield Fund. Template tweaks go to the comms folks; delivery failures and bounce weirdness go to the platform crew. Don't push template changes on Fridays — receipts batch over the weekend. For anything GiftNote-related, start with the address below.

billing contact of kaweg-tajeg = drudor.lamion.oliath@torvalabs.test

**PR: Add allocation snapshots to the Varrow GPU profiler**

This change adds periodic device-memory snapshots to the Varrow profiler sidecar so we can attribute fragmentation to specific kernels before the cut. Overhead stays under two percent in our bench runs, and snapshots are disabled unless the flag is set. For the release build, please confirm the shipped defaults match the constants listed below.

constants for bawif-kawif:
QUOTAS = {
    "ulaael": 5,
    "holael": 10,
}